Course Overview

This intensive 1 Day training equips you with practical frameworks to evaluate startup ideas using structured business modeling and feasibility research. You will learn how to break down your idea into a clear Business Model Canvas, analyze market demand, assess competitors, evaluate financial viability, and test assumptions through MVP-based validation. The course integrates analytical tools, real-world cases, and strategic thinking to ensure your idea is robust, scalable, and investment-ready.

Agenda
Module 1: Understanding Startup Feasibility Foundations

Info: • Learn how feasibility research shapes startup success
• Identify core assumptions behind idea validation
• Explore failure patterns and how to avoid them
• Icebreaker


Module 2: Business Model Canvas Deep Dive

Info: • Break down your idea into 9 essential canvas components
• Understand customer segments, value propositions, and key activities
• Learn how to design a scalable business model
• Activity


Module 3: Market Need & Problem Validation

Info: • Conduct market need assessment using industry and customer insights
• Map real customer problems vs. perceived assumptions
• Evaluate market gaps and unmet demand
• Case Study


Module 4: Competitor & Industry Research

Info: • Analyze direct, indirect, and substitute competitors
• Study competitive advantages, pricing, and differentiation
• Use competitor insights to refine your startup model
• Group Brainstorm


Module 5: Financial & Operational Feasibility

Info: • Assess cost structures, revenue models, and breakeven points
• Validate financial sustainability and operational practicality
• Understand funding needs, risks, and financial projections
• Simulation


Module 6: MVP Design & Testing Feasibility

Info: • Learn MVP approaches for rapid validation
• Create testing hypotheses and measurable indicators
• Understand iterative improvement based on user feedback
• Role Play


Module 7: Risk Assessment & Feasibility Scoring

Info: • Identify internal and external risks that affect feasibility
• Use scoring frameworks to evaluate idea strength
• Build a readiness checklist for launch decisions
